云服务器免费试用

socket send函数怎么使用

服务器知识 0 869

Socket的send函数是用来发送数据的,其使用方式如下:
1. 创建Socket对象:
```python
import socket
# 创建TCP套接字
s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
```
2. 连接到服务端:
```python
# 连接到服务端
server_address = ('localhost', 8888)
sock.connect(server_address)
```
3. 使用send发送数据:
```python
# 发送数据
data = "Hello, server!"
sock.send(data.encode())
```
4. 关闭Socket连接:
```python
# 关闭连接
sock.close()
```
完整的示例代码如下:
```python
import socket
# 创建TCP套接字
s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
# 连接到服务端
server_address = ('localhost', 8888)
sock.connect(server_address)
# 发送数据
data = "Hello, server!"
sock.send(data.encode())
# 关闭连接
sock.close()
```
注意: send函数发送的数据必须是字节类型,如果是字符串类型需要先进行编码转换。

socket send函数怎么使用

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942@q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: socket send函数怎么使用
本文地址: https://solustack.com/59137.html

相关推荐:

网友留言:

我要评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。